/Simple-Commerce

Simple crud app with Laravel

Primary LanguagePHPApache License 2.0Apache-2.0

Kurulum için aşağıdaki komutları sırası ile yazınız.

git clone https://github.com/atalhatabak/Simple-Commerce.git

cd Simple-Commerce

composer install

npm install

php artisan storage:link

Bağımlılıklar;

Composer, Npm, Php

bu dizinde php artisan serve komutu ile server başlatılabilir

ayrıca farklı bir terminal penceresinden npm run dev komutu frontend serveri başlatınız

Not: Veritabanı olarak sqlite kullanılıyor ve dabase klasörü içerisinde Database.sqlite olarak depolanıyor Php sqlite eklentisini aktif hale getirmek için php.ini içerisindeki extension=pdo_sqlite satırının başındaki yorum satırı ibaresini kaldırın

Proje Hakkında

Admin panel linki /admin

giriş için admin yetkisine sahip kullanıcının giriş yapmış olması gerekiyor

Kullanıcı Bilgileri

e-posta: admin@gmail.com

şifre: testtest

Screenshot_20231208_175958 Login ekranı, herhangi bir işlem için zorunlu Screenshot_20231208_180041 Ana sayfa ürünler sayfası, ürünlerin marka ve türüne göre bağlantı var ve bu bağlantı ile filtreleme yapılabiliyor Screenshot_20231208_180142 Türüne Göre Screenshot_20231208_180150 Markasına Göre

Screenshot_20231208_180228 Admin Paneli, Resim ekleniyor ve anlık eklenen resim görüntüleniyor. alt tarafta ürünleri listeliyor

Özellikler: CRUD: 30 puan resim ekleme: 10 puan Bağımsız Admin paneli, html + css ile yazıldı: 10 puan arayüz: 10 puan Admin panel oturumu: 10 puan